Transaction 6709c43ba8b66c8851714bd442d1d5348741d6882bae097dc682b2813e91e970

7 Input
2 Outputs
  • 6709c43ba8b66c8851714bd442d1d5348741d6882bae097dc682b2813e91e970:0
  • value  32990000
    address  32uFEGzfZaG9a75SasQtfbbgmnJtjKazii
  • 6709c43ba8b66c8851714bd442d1d5348741d6882bae097dc682b2813e91e970:1
  • value  17403539
    address  35hJ2KSi3EtwEZ4kVxzCj5LwRvoEi8aPzM